Check out the comments left by our users about this educational center (LILA - Liverpool International Language Academy). In this educational center (LILA - Liverpool International Language Academy) you can enter your opinion so that other users can consult. In our database Liverpool has this college at New Barratt House
47 N John St
Liverpool L2 6SG
United Kingdom. If you find anything wrong in our website, please contact our team www.schoolsok.co.uk CONTACT.
The communication between the educational center and city (Liverpool) are acceptable.